Construction Jobs in Mississippi: Frequently Asked Questions

Which construction companies sponsor visas in Mississippi?

Major visa sponsors include Yates Construction (headquartered in Philadelphia, MS), BL Harbert International with projects across the state, Roy Anderson Corporation in Gulfport, and Ergon Inc for industrial construction. Casino resort developers like MGM and Boyd Gaming also sponsor visas for construction managers and specialized trades during major expansion projects.

Which visa types are most common for construction roles in Mississippi?

H-2B visas dominate for seasonal construction workers, especially during hurricane recovery and casino construction cycles. H-1B visas are common for civil engineers, project managers, and specialized roles in petrochemical construction. TN visas work well for Canadian and Mexican professionals in engineering and project management positions with major Mississippi contractors.

Which cities in Mississippi have the most construction sponsorship jobs?

Jackson leads with government and commercial projects, followed by Gulfport for shipbuilding and hurricane recovery construction. Biloxi and Tunica offer casino and hospitality construction opportunities. Pascagoula has industrial construction tied to shipyards and refineries, while Hattiesburg benefits from university expansion and regional development projects requiring skilled international workers.

What prevailing wage considerations affect construction visa applications in Mississippi?

Mississippi's lower prevailing wages compared to coastal states can complicate H-1B applications for construction management roles. However, this creates opportunities for cost-conscious employers to sponsor international talent. Davis-Bacon prevailing wage requirements on federal projects often exceed local market rates, making visa sponsorship more economically viable for government construction contracts.

What is the prevailing wage for sponsored construction jobs in Mississippi?

U.S. employers sponsoring a visa must pay at least the prevailing wage, which is what workers in the same role, area, and experience level typically earn. The Department of Labor sets this rate to make sure companies aren't hiring foreign workers simply because they'd accept lower pay than a U.S. worker. It varies by job title, location, and experience. You can look up current prevailing wage rates for any occupation and location using the OFLC Wage Search page.
